A solenoid 24vac is an electromagnetic actuator designed to convert electrical energy into linear mechanical motion using a 24-volt alternating current power supply. This essential component consists of a wire coil wound around a movable ferromagnetic plunger that creates magnetic force when energized. The solenoid 24vac operates by generating a magnetic field that pulls or pushes the plunger to perform switching, locking, or valve control functions in automated systems. These devices are widely recognized for their reliability, simplicity, and versatility across industrial and commercial applications. The 24-volt AC voltage standard makes the solenoid 24vac particularly suitable for control systems that require safe, low-voltage operation while maintaining sufficient power for consistent performance. Key technological features include rapid response times, long operational life cycles, and compatibility with standard control panels and automation equipment. The solenoid 24vac finds extensive use in HVAC systems, irrigation controllers, industrial machinery, security access systems, and fluid control applications. Engineers and system designers prefer these actuators because they integrate seamlessly with programmable logic controllers and building management systems. The compact design allows for installation in space-constrained environments, while the AC power compatibility eliminates the need for rectification circuits. Modern solenoid 24vac units incorporate advanced materials that resist corrosion and withstand demanding operational conditions, ensuring consistent performance across temperature variations and extended duty cycles. Their straightforward installation process and minimal maintenance requirements make them a practical choice for both new installations and retrofit projects.

Enhanced Durability Through AC Operation

Enhanced Durability Through AC Operation

The solenoid 24vac leverages alternating current characteristics to deliver superior durability compared to many direct current alternatives. The AC waveform naturally creates intermittent magnetic field variations that prevent continuous maximum stress on internal components, distributing wear more evenly across the coil windings and plunger surfaces. This operational characteristic significantly reduces heat buildup during extended activation periods, as the zero-crossing points in the AC cycle provide brief moments for thermal dissipation. The result is a solenoid 24vac that maintains consistent performance even in demanding continuous-duty applications where sustained energization is required. The reduced thermal stress extends insulation life, prevents premature coil failure, and maintains pull force characteristics over time. Manufacturing processes for solenoid 24vac units typically incorporate robust materials specifically selected for AC operation, including specialized laminated cores that minimize eddy current losses and high-temperature wire insulation that withstands prolonged exposure to operational heat. This engineering approach ensures your investment delivers reliable service across years of operation, minimizing unexpected failures and the associated costs of emergency repairs or system downtime. The enhanced durability proves particularly valuable in applications where accessibility is limited or where replacement requires significant labor investment.
Seamless Integration with Standard Control Systems

Seamless Integration with Standard Control Systems

The solenoid 24vac offers exceptional compatibility with existing automation infrastructure, making it an ideal choice for both new installations and system upgrades. The 24-volt AC voltage standard represents one of the most common control voltages in industrial automation, building management systems, and process control applications worldwide. This universality means the solenoid 24vac connects directly to standard control transformers, relay outputs, and programmable logic controllers without requiring voltage conversion modules or special interface circuits. Engineers appreciate this straightforward integration because it reduces design complexity, shortens commissioning time, and simplifies troubleshooting procedures. Maintenance technicians benefit from the familiarity of working with standard voltage levels and conventional wiring practices that align with established electrical codes and workplace safety protocols. The solenoid 24vac typically features standardized mounting dimensions and connection terminals that facilitate replacement of existing actuators or expansion of current systems. This interchangeability reduces procurement challenges and allows for flexible sourcing strategies. The widespread adoption of 24VAC control standards ensures that supporting components, diagnostic tools, and technical expertise remain readily available, providing long-term support confidence for your automation investments and reducing the risk of obsolescence as technology evolves.
Versatile Application Adaptability

Versatile Application Adaptability

The solenoid 24vac demonstrates remarkable versatility across diverse operational environments and application requirements, making it a practical solution for multiple system needs. In fluid control applications, the solenoid 24vac reliably operates water valves, gas flow regulators, and hydraulic directional controls, providing precise on-off or proportional control depending on the specific valve design. HVAC systems utilize these actuators for damper control, refrigerant flow management, and zone regulation, where the reliable performance directly impacts energy efficiency and occupant comfort. Security and access control systems depend on the solenoid 24vac for electric door strikes, magnetic locks, and gate operators, where consistent actuation ensures both security integrity and user convenience. Industrial machinery incorporates these components for pneumatic valve actuation, parts sorting mechanisms, and automated assembly processes where timing precision and operational reliability determine production quality and throughput. The solenoid 24vac adapts to outdoor installations through weatherproof enclosure options, operates in extreme temperature environments with appropriate specification selection, and accommodates various mounting orientations to fit spatial constraints.
